It is ordered that: 1. Order CEL-01631-21 is cancelled. 2. The tenancy between the Landlord and the Tenant is terminated. The Tenant must move out of the rental unit on or before January 28, 2022 (standard 11 days from the issuance date of this order). 3. The Tenant shall pay to the Landlord $3,134.64*. This amount represents the rent owing up to January 17, 2022 and the costs related to the application fee for the previous application, less the rent deposit and interest the Landlord owes on the rent deposit. 4. The Tenant shall also pay to the Landlord $37.81 per day for compensation for the use of the unit starting January 18, 2022 to the date the Tenant moves out of the unit. 5. If the Tenant does not pay the Landlord the full amount owing* on or before January 28, 2022, the Tenant will start to owe interest. This will be simple interest calculated from January 29, 2022 at 2.00% annually on the balance outstanding. 6. If the unit is not vacated on or before January 28, 2022, then starting January 29, 2022, the Landlord may file this order with the Court Enforcement Office (Sheriff) so that the eviction may be enforced. 7. Upon receipt of this order, the Court Enforcement Office (Sheriff) is directed to give vacant possession of the unit to the Landlord on or after January 29, 2022. January 17, 2022 Date Issued Michelle Tan Member, Landlord and Tenant Board Central-RO 3 Robert Speck Pkwy, 5th Floor Mississauga ON L4Z2G5 The tenant has until January 28, 2022 to file a motion with the Board to set aside the order under s. 78(9) of the Act.
